Terra L Smith, Age 53

Pearl, MS
Search Report

Known As:

Terra Louise Smith, Terra L Byrd, Terra L Dennis, Terria Smith

Phone Numbers
(901) 213-3856 + 1 more
Used to Live in
Jackson, MS + 8 more
UNLOCK REPORT

Phones and Addresses

View All Info

FAQ about Terra L Smith

  • What is Terra L Smith’s phone number?

    Terra L Smith’s phone number is (901) 213-3856.

  • What is Terra L Smith’s date of birth?

    Terra L Smith was born on 1971.